Skip to main content

On Sale: GamesAssetsToolsTabletopComics
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
TagsGame Engines

[Dev Log] Camp Ravenrock - Queer SF/Fantasy Summer School VN

A topic by Metaparadox created Oct 09, 2017 Views: 699 Replies: 6
Viewing posts 1 to 7
Submitted (1 edit)


I was actually working on this game since last month before knowing that this jam was a thing! I've been expanding on a project I started in 2015 but didn't get very far with called Camp Ravenrock. It's a mostly linear SF/Fantasy summer school VN with daily randomly placed events and the option of taking four different classes or skipping. There's a lot of different stats for classes, friendships, and romances that are affected by how you talk to people, what you choose to do in various situations, or what you don't do. Every romance option is WLW, with five romance-able characters, with some nuance surrounding gray-aromanticism with one of the characters. In addition to this you can cultivate friendships with three other characters, all of whom are queer in other ways, and make one sort-of friendship with one other character. Most of the characters are either POC or have an appearance not analogous to a human race. The main character is named by the player, and doesn't have a stated race, but is ambiguously brown. There are also interactions with four teachers and four student counsellors. There are non-binary and ace characters!

The game is set in a world I've been developing for the past ten or so years, a world very similar to our own where there is an underground community of "Nons" on Earth, short for non-humans, which in practice means anyone with any non-human ancestry, most of whom have some sort of superpowers. Also, Atlantis and several other pre-ancient civilizations existed, and they left the earth behind to settle underground on the Moon and other planets/moons. Their existence is known to the Non community and select government officials, but is otherwise hidden until several hundred years in the future, which is outside of the scope of this game and most of the stories I've written set in the game's universe. The game is heavily influenced by the game Magical Diary, which is of course vaguely inspired by Harry Potter, but the school in Camp Ravenrock is much closer to Xavier's School in X-Men, mixed with a bit of Area 51. And then there's the whole parallel universe thing, which I can't get into much without spoilers, and the aeşen (EYE-shen), who are somewhat godlike energy beings who collectively make up the soul and consciousness of a planet. They intermix with humans, which is why most of the Non community are "partials." In this world, most "mythological" creatures and "gods" are actually aeşen or partials, though the myths don't always get everything right about them.

The game's plot is mostly about a name-able protagonist going away to the Ravenrock Academy for Exceptional Students' Summer Session for a month, making friends and potentially finding romance while learning about the Non world that she has just been able to enter. She grew up knowing it was a thing, since her parents were also partials, but was never able to use her ability openly... until now! You get to choose from five potential abilities at the beginning of the game, which will influence events and how the ability classes work. There is also a secret plot going on under the surface that I won't spoil. If you don't attend the right classes and do the right things, you might not even notice it's going on, but it will eventually become impossible to ignore.

Right now all the placeholder character art is by me, while the music and backgrounds are free stuff I found on the internet. I'll post some screenshots soon. I haven't done anything to change the default Ren'Py UI yet, but it will be done.

Submitted

Some current screenshots! I apologize for my terrible art and the default UI! Also, I forgot to mention that there are disabled characters! Including an autistic character!







Submitted

Here's the (probably) final art for the romance-able characters! It's not perfect, but I don't really have the time to re-do it again.


Submitted

Just finished digging into the Ren'Py default themes to make a custom version of the TV theme for my game. I wanted pretty button backgrounds. It took me a while, but I did it! And customized the text boxes! And changed the game's resolution!

Using a free background for now for the main menu screen.



As you can see, there's still a lot of placeholder artwork.

Submitted

I like the look of this. Looking forward to seeing how it turns out. 

Submitted (1 edit)

Well, I've made a lot of progress on writing, fixing transitions and transforms, and did some art fixes. I'm 26,000 words in, including placeholders to be expanded.

Still To Do:

  • Write 3.5 random events (so far I've written half of one and plotted out in detail the other 26 for the full game)
  • Write 12 class periods (so far I've written 4 and planned the rest for the full game)
  • Write 3 class skipping events (so far I've written 1)
  • Finish sprites for 4 friend characters, player character, 4 teachers, and 4 counsellors
  • Finish drawing auditorium background
  • Maybe: work on original background art
  • Maybe: work on minigames for ability classes

YIKES! I've got a lot to finish in like ten days. But I've got the gist of what I need to finish for the demo to be done in time. I'll release it even if it's not totally done though; I'll just leave in the placeholders. The main structure is all done.

Submitted

Haven't gotten as much done as I would have liked, but the deadline's been extended a day, so I still have this much left to do in less than 2 days:

  • Write 2 random events
  • Write 6 class periods
  • Draw sprites for 2 counsellor characters (or 7 characters (4 counsellors and 3 friends) if I want to replace all the placeholder sprites)
  • Finish auditorium background
  • Find some photos for a few short scene backgrounds
  • All the maybes are out for now

This seems much more doable now!